Long-expression well being and protection outcomes are not properly comprehended. Because kratom investigation is fairly new in comparison to research on extra extensively applied medication, There is certainly minimal proof to find out how kratom use may well have an effect on somebody after some time.

Regulations have banned kratom use in numerous U.S. states or counties; even so, kratom isn't currently controlled at the Federal level. Some states have fully classified kratom as a plan I substance or to be a banned compound, such as: Alabama

The plant's active compounds and metabolites are not detected by a typical drug screening test, but may be detected by far more specialised screening.

Kratom is scheduled to become an unlawful material in Indonesia in 2024 when new laws in the Indonesian Countrywide Narcotics Agency (BNN) go Benefits of Kratom into influence.[85] This pending ban has been in place considering the fact that 2019; the day of your ban heading into impact was pushed out to 2024 to give Kratom farmers time to switch to other crops.

The majority of the psychoactive consequences of kratom have advanced from anecdotal and circumstance studies. Kratom has an unusual motion of manufacturing each stimulant effects at decreased doses and much more CNS depressant Unwanted side effects at better doses.

Investigation on potential therapeutic effects of kratom is ongoing. Scientists haven't tested kratom to be Secure or powerful for almost any professional medical intent, nevertheless kratom has been used in traditional drugs.eighteen Many of us who use kratom products report doing this to self-handle ache, stress, depression, exhaustion, and drug cravings and withdrawal signs or symptoms (In particular associated with opioid use).

The second discomfort section is due to an inflammatory response, when the principal reaction is acute damage on the nerve fibers. Conolidine injection was found to suppress both equally the section 1 and a pair of pain response (sixty). This implies conolidine efficiently suppresses both chemically or inflammatory suffering Conolidine of equally an acute and persistent mother nature. Even more analysis by Tarselli et al. found conolidine to have no affinity for the mu-opioid receptor, suggesting a distinct method of motion from standard opiate analgesics. Moreover, this analyze unveiled that the drug will not change locomotor action in mice subjects, suggesting a lack of Unintended effects like sedation or addiction located in other dopamine-selling substances (sixty).

Researchers have lately determined and succeeded in synthesizing conolidine, a natural compound that displays assure like a strong analgesic agent with a far more favorable security profile. Even though the actual system of action remains elusive, it can be currently postulated that conolidine could have many biologic targets. Presently, conolidine has long been proven to inhibit Cav2.2 calcium channels and enhance The provision of endogenous opioid peptides by binding to the just lately recognized opioid scavenger ACKR3. Even though the identification of conolidine as a possible novel analgesic agent supplies yet another avenue to deal with the opioid disaster and regulate CNCP, further more scientific studies are needed to comprehend its system of motion and utility and efficacy in taking care of CNCP.

We demonstrated that, in distinction to classical opioid receptors, ACKR3 would not trigger classical G protein signaling and is not modulated with the classical prescription or analgesic opioids, for example mor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ists which include naloxone. In its place, we founded that LIH383, an ACKR3-selective subnanomolar competitor peptide, prevents ACKR3’s negative regulatory purpose on opioid peptides within an ex vivo rat brain product and potentiates their activity toward classical opioid receptors.

Conolidine has one of a kind qualities that can be valuable for that management of Long-term discomfort. Conolidine is found in the bark of your flowering shrub T. divaricata

Inside a recent analyze, we described the identification as well as characterization of a completely new atypical opioid receptor with exceptional adverse regulatory Qualities to opioid peptides.1 Our results confirmed that kratom ACKR3/CXCR7, hitherto called an atypical scavenger receptor for chemokines CXCL12 and CXCL11, can be a broad-spectrum scavenger for opioid peptides of your enkephalin, dynorphin, and nociceptin households, regulating their availability for classical opioid receptors.

Pathophysiological variations in the periphery and central nervous system cause peripheral and central sensitization, thus transitioning the improperly managed acute soreness into a Persistent ache condition or persistent pain affliction (three). Although noxious stimuli historically trigger the perception of suffering, it may also be produced by lesions during the peripheral or central anxious methods. Continual non-most cancers agony (CNCP), which persists beyond the assumed typical tissue healing time of 3 months, is documented by more than thirty% of usa citizens (four).

In 2011, the Bohn lab pointed out antinociception against each chemically induced and inflammation-derived discomfort, and experiments indicated lack of opioid receptor inhibition, but were struggling to determine a certain goal.

Tabernaemontana divaricata Conolidine is definitely an indole alkaloid. Preliminary stories recommend that it could give analgesic consequences with handful of on the harmful aspect-results connected with opioids such as morphine, nevertheless At this time it's got only been evaluated in mouse models.

Elucidating the precise pharmacological mechanism of action (MOA) of naturally taking place compounds might be complicated. Despite the fact that Tarselli et al. (60) produced the 1st de novo synthetic pathway to conolidine and showcased this By natural means taking place compound efficiently suppresses responses to each chemically induced and inflammation-derived discomfort, the pharmacologic target liable for its antinociceptive action remained elusive. Specified the troubles connected with normal pharmacological and physiological approaches, Mendis et al. utilized cultured neuronal networks developed on multi-electrode array (MEA) engineering coupled with sample matching response profiles to offer a potential MOA of conolidine (61). A comparison of drug results from the MEA cultures of central nervous technique Energetic compounds identified that the response profile of conolidine was most just like that of ω-conotoxin CVIE, a Cav2.

This compound was also tested for mu-opioid receptor action, and like conolidine, was uncovered to acquire no exercise at the location. Utilizing the identical paw injection examination, a number of alternate options with larger efficacy have been identified that inhibited the Preliminary soreness reaction, indicating opiate-like action. Specified different mechanisms of such conolidine derivatives, it absolutely was also suspected they would offer this analgesic result devoid of mimicking opiate Negative effects (sixty three). Precisely the same group synthesized added conolidine derivatives, finding an additional compound generally known as 15a that had comparable Houses and did not bind the mu-opioid receptor (sixty six).

The main asymmetric complete synthesis of conolidine was made by Micalizio and coworkers in 2011.[2] This synthetic route lets access to either enantiomer (mirror picture) of conolidine by using an early enzymatic resolution.
